Two large arms caches found in Chechnya
Police found the first cache in the village of Starogladkovskaya in the Shelkovskoi district in northeastern Chechnya. The cache contained an RPG-26 grenade launcher, a mortar and a home-made grenade launcher, a Kalashnikov assault rifle, two large-caliber shells, a mine, eight rounds for grenade launchers, two grenades, more than 100 7.62mm cartridges and 100 grams of plastic explosives, the source said.
Police found the second cache in the basement of the former water pumping station in the city of Argun in eastern Chechnya. The cache contained an RPG-26 grenade launcher, two home-made grenade launchers, three Kalashnikov machine guns, two Kalashnikov assault rifles, 326 30mm cartridges, four mines, 14 rounds for grenade launchers, four grenades and more than 150 cartridges of various calibers.
"All the weapons and ammunition have been seized and an investigation has been launched," the source said.
